Abstract


Compensation and Benefit Department (C&B) has some scope of works which is develop organization structure, job description, policy, and standard operating procedure. Time accuracy is the most important thing for C&B Department for doing the main jobs.  Risk analysis needs to be done in every activity for identify potential risk that might happen. Risk analysis method is assisted by two tools that is Failure Mode Effect Analysis (FMEA) and Fishbone Diagram. Potential risk, cause of failure and Risk Priority Number (RPN) might be identify from those methods. A high RPN needs to be handled first. Analysis results shows that moderate and high risks activities are regarding document approval to both the Manager and the Director. Design of improvements have been made to improve the activity. The proposed of improvements is given that the C&B team must be more proactive to follow up with the Manager or Director so that failure becomes easier to detect and is expected to reduce the value of the RPN in that activity.
